    On my 99 379 with a c15 6nz im trying to find the tach output wire im trying to put in a remote starter thanks

    The tach is ran off a two wire sensor screwed into the rear structure of the engine. Reads off the flywheel teeth. It could be on either right or left side, about the 5 or 7 o'clock position. I was thinking usually right side on that one.
